How Are Custom One Piece Shoes Made?
Creating custom One Piece shoes involves creativity, skill, and the right materials. Professional artists and specialty shops use several customization methods:
1. Hand-Painting
This is the classic approach where artists paint directly onto shoes, often using leather or canvas sneakers like Nike Air Force 1s or Vans. The process involves:
- Sketching the design in pencil
- Layering acrylic or leather paint for vivid colors
- Adding details and outlines with fine brushes
- Sealing the artwork to protect against weather and wear
2. Heat Transfer Printing
For crisp and detailed designs, heat transfer printing is used:
- Artwork is printed onto special transfer paper
- Using heat and pressure, the design is moved onto the shoe’s surface
- Suitable for intricate and colorful images
3. 3D Printing & Embroidery
Some advanced shops offer 3D-printed shoes or embroidery:
- 3D printing can create molded accents or logos
- Embroidery adds texture with stitched patterns or character emblems
4. Combination Techniques
Many customizers combine painting, printing, and embroidery for multi-dimensional results.

Understanding the Cost (and Shipping)
Custom One Piece shoes can range widely in price depending on the base shoe, design complexity, and artist reputation.
Typical Cost Breakdown
- Base shoe cost (e.g., $50–$120 for Nike or Converse)
- Art fee (from $80 to $400+ depending on detail)
- Shipping fees (domestic cheaper; overseas can add $20–$50)
- Customs or import duties for international buyers

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How long does it take to make custom One Piece shoes?
Most custom shoes take 2–6 weeks to create, depending on design complexity, artist schedule, and supply chain factors. Always confirm timeline expectations before ordering.
2. Will the artwork peel or fade with use?
Professional customizers use high-quality paints and sealants to protect designs. However, avoiding harsh conditions, heavy scrubbing, and soaking extends the artwork’s lifespan.
3. Can I wash my custom shoes?
Spot cleaning with a soft cloth is recommended. Avoid submerging or machine-washing your shoes, as water and agitation can damage the custom art.
4. What happens if the shoes don’t fit?
Because custom shoes are made-to-order, returns or exchanges for size issues can be tricky. Always confirm your size accurately and check the shop’s policy before ordering.
5. Can I request any One Piece design I want?
Most custom artists welcome creative requests—whether that’s a specific character, quote, or scene. The more detailed your description and references, the better they can bring your vision to life. Some shops may have design restrictions, so it’s always best to ask first.
